Fritsch Planetary Mills of the classic line are ideally suited for wet and dry comminution of hard, medium-hard, brittle and fibrous materials. Samples can be processed from a few milligrams to several kilograms at a wide range of fineness levels down to less than 1 μm. They are absolutely reliable, especially easy to operate and clean. Matching grinding parts of various materials are also available to provide maximum protection against undesired contamination of the samples.

The Planetary Mono Mill PULVERISETTE 6 classic line is a high-performance Planetary Ball Mill with a single grinding bowl mount and practical, easily adjustable imbalance compensation.

The instrument is particularly easy to use and provides a high-energy effect up to 650 rpm. This ensures a constantly high grinding performance with extremely low space requirements for loss-free grinding results, even in suspension.

The electronic timer adjustable to one second and the programmable, automated reversing feature ensure precise, consistent reproducibility and grinding of even the smallest samples. At the same time, the PULVERISETTE 6 classic line is ideally suited for mechanical alloying or for mixing and perfect homogenising of emulsions and pastes.

Additional advantages include: low space requirements and ergonomic design; timer programming precise to ± one second; perfect mixing and homogenising of emulsions; simultaneous processing of up to 2 samples; useful capacity up to 225 ml; bowl sizes 80 ml, 250 ml and 500 ml volume.
